Esther M. Gorman, 101, of Williamsport and formerly of Berwick, died peacefully Sunday, July 7, 2024 at the Williamsport Home.
Born May 14, 1923 in Nescopeck she was a daughter of the late Atwood and Ethel (Paden) Lynn.
For many years Esther worked in banking as a teller. She enjoyed reading, flowers and working in her garden. Her green thumb was a symbol of her ability to bring forth life and beauty, much like the way she enriched the lives of others through her loving nature.
Surviving are a daughter Lynn Morrow (Frank) of Williamsport; two granddaughters, Erin Gehron of Williamsport and Jamie Connelly (David) of Pittsburgh; four great-grandchildren, Lillian and Cameron Connelly, Isabella and Lydia Gehron; five siblings, Ernie Lynn, Evelyn Orlando, Martha Biacchi, Judy Thomas, and D. Jo Barton, as well as several nieces and nephews.
Esther was preceded in death by her husband, James P. Gorman in 2005 after 52 years of marriage; a grandson, Seth Morrow and three siblings, Mary Agoston, Ray Lynn and Leonard Lynn.
A private burial will be held in Elan Memorial Park, Bloomsburg.
In lieu of flowers memorial contributions may be made in Esther’s name to the Williamsport Home, 1900 Ravine Rd. Williamsport, PA 17701.
